Draymond declines option, to become free agent

Golden State Warriors forward Draymond Green is declining his $27.6 million player option for next season, his agent, Rich Paul of Klutch Sports, told ESPN’s Adrian Wojnarowski on Monday.

“We will continue to talk to Golden State and explore all options,” Paul told ESPN.

It was expected Green would opt out and now he can talk with the Warriors as well as explore sign-and-trades and free agency.

The Warriors, though, have been motivated to sign Green on a new deal, sources said.
